WILLIAMSBURG (WVDN) – The next Williamsburg Shooting Match will be on Saturday, Feb. 4, at the Williamsburg Community Building. All proceeds will go to the Jack Goodman Scholarship Fund. There will be an expanded menu of food, and concessions will open at 5 p.m., an hour earlier than usual. Food is dine-in or carry out.

The shooting match will begin at 7 p.m. There are eight rounds, 12-gauge guns only, full choke, .660 inch minimum. Screw-in chokes must be from a recognized supplier (patented) and extend no more than three inches beyond original barrel. Barrel length 34 inches maximum.

First seven rounds are $2 per shot, eighth round 50/50 is $6 per shot. Shooters must compete in the first seven rounds in order to compete in the eighth round.

50/50 splatter match is $1 per chance between rounds – cash prizes will be awarded. You do not need to be a shooter to win.

Families are welcome; you don’t have to shoot to get a meal.

The match will be held at the Williamsburg Community Building, 6571 Shoestring Trail, Williamsburg.

The event is sponsored by a joint effort of the Williamsburg Community Action and the Williamsburg Ruritans.
